u/theendofdaysagain Unverified/Not an LEO 4h ago

1: Stay in shape. 2: Take your dinner and snacks. 3: Take the job off with the uniform.

Book recommendations:

The Bible. Jim Cirillo spoke of it on video and in his books. The guys in the heavy action who had the least amount of problems after shootings, especially after multiple ones, were those who had a strong faith and trust in God. And who also shot in competitions.

Cirillo's books.

On Killing - Lt Col Dave Grossman On spiritual combat On spiritual warfare

Unrepentant Sinner - Charles Askins
